Technical Specifications
Fuel Petrol Petrol
Engine Displacement 645.00 cc 689.00 cc
Engine 4-stroke, liquid-cooled, DOHC, 90˚ V-twin Liquid-cooled, 4-stroke, DOHC inline twin-cylinder; 4-valves per cylinder
Engine Starting Electric --
Engine Lubrication Wet sump --
Clutch Wet, multi-plate type --
Fuel System Fuel injection, SDTV-equipped Fuel injection
Ignition Electronic ignition (transistorized) --
Transmission 6-speed constant mesh 6-speed; multiplate wet clutch; with Assist & Slipper clutch
Drivetrain Chain, RK525SMOZ8, 118 links Final Drive: Chain
Headlamp 12V 65W (H9 high-beam) and 12V 55W (H7 low-beam) --
Taillamp LED --
Tyres
Front 110/80R19 M/C (59V), tubeless 120/70ZR17 Bridgestone® BATTLAX HYPERSPORT S22F
Rear 150/70R17 M/C (69V), tubeless 180/55ZR17 Bridgestone® BATTLAX HYPERSPORT S22R
Brakes
Front Tokico, 2-piston calipers, twin disc, ABS-equipped 298mm dual disc hydraulic with ABS
Rear Nissin, 1-piston, single disc, ABS-equipped 245mm disc hydraulic with ABS
Suspension
Front Telescopic, coil spring, oil damped Telescopic fork; 5.1-in travel, adjustable for preload, rebound and compression
Rear Link type, single shock, coil spring, oil damped Linked-type Monocross shock, adjustable preload and rebound; 5.1-in travel
Colors Available
Colors Champion Yellow Heritage White/Redline


Physical Specs
Length 2275 mm 2070 mm
Width 910 mm 706 mm
Height 1405 mm 1160 mm
Kerb Weight 216 --
Seat Height 835 835
Wheelbase 1560 mm 1394 mm
Ground Clearance 170 mm 134 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 20.0 litres 13 litres
